Transaction 58777b65267596c422abbe03d3f292af8cfda270f5574e9dde6b3a5e9e02cd74
1 Input
1 Output
-
58777b65267596c422abbe03d3f292af8cfda270f5574e9dde6b3a5e9e02cd74:0
- value
- 85044
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2883a34678d94773d1fdd064f25e1544406d101
- address
- bc1q72yr5dr83k28w0glm5ry7f0p23zqd5gpfz2sla